The latest NS9 Postgame Show dives into one of the most entertaining Pirates wins of the season—a 5–4 victory over the Brewers. Cody and Jim break down a game packed with action, highlighted by Nick Gonzales going 5-for-5 and Tommy Pham launching his first home run of the year. Braxton Ashcraft impressed in his first MLB start, Isaac Mattson looked dominant out of the bullpen, and David Bednar continued his month-long scoreless streak despite some shaky moments. The guys also touch on some questionable baserunning, the continued struggles of Oneil Cruz, and whether Henry Davis deserves more time behind the plate. As always, the conversation turns spicy when Bednar trade rumors come up—and Jim doesn’t hold back on why the Pirates need to keep players who actually want to be here.
